Fonda

(FAHN-də)

Fonda Name Meaning. ... Catalan: possibly a topographic name from fonda 'inn', from Arabic funduq, or perhaps a nickname from fonda 'slingshot'. The name may also be Italian, a habitational name from a place named with the adjective fondo, fonda 'deep', for example Cavafonda 'deep cave' or Vallefonda.
